SF Planning Commission Hearing
Agenda
By
Robert Prinz
10:30 AM PDT on September 4, 2012
On the agenda:
- Two-year authorization for 24 space surface parking lot at 38th 8th St (west side between Market and Mission Streets)
- Consideration of parking tax simplification for residential properties, when renting out 5 or fewer spaces
- Conditional use authorization for 4-20 Octavia Blvd mixed-use project
- Conditional use authorization to allow construction of the Chinatown Transit Subway Station entrance structure at southwest corner of Stockton and Washington Streets
